Abstract

This document outlines the general orientation, aims, and thematic structure for the 4th World Congress on Action Research, Action Learning, and Process Management, and the 8th World Congress on Participatory Action-Research, held in December 1995 in Bogotá, Colombia. The congresses focus on convergence in knowledge, space, and time, addressing themes such as methodology, evaluation, and future projections of work in the fields of action research, participatory learning, and social transformation.

Description

The congresses aim to engage academics, professionals, and social leaders in discussions on the evolution of action research methodologies, participatory approaches, and the development of new paradigms for socio-economic, cultural, and political organization. The document includes themes, sub-themes, and organizational details, including calls for papers, registration instructions, and the proposed congress structure.
